THE REVELATION OF JESUS CHRIST

The last Book of the Bible completes God's message about Jesus Christ and the coming Kingdom. It was given by God to Jesus (Revelation 1:1), to show his servants things which were yet to happen before Jesus is revealed from heaven. It was made known to John while he was in exile on the isle of Patmos, just off the south-west coast of Asia (modern Turkey).

Given in symbolic language ("signified", 1:1) the book can only be properly understood in the light of the rest of Scripture. The early chapters, addressed to the seven "churches" or ecclesias in Asia (see map below), are easier to understand. They contain vital advice for us today.
